K-pop overtakes dramas as main purveyor of the Korean wave


JONATHAN M. HICAP
Manila Bulletin 
MANILA, Philippines -- A decade ago, Korean dramas were the main driver of hallyu, or the Korean wave, with such hits “Winter Sonata,” “Jewel in the Palace,” “My Name is Kim Sam Soon” and “Coffee Prince."
But with the explosion of the internet and social networking sites such as Facebook, YouTube and Twitter in the past few years, Korean pop music, or K-pop, has overtaken Korean dramas to become the  top purveyor of the Korean wave worldwide.

Rapper gets suspended sentence; Super Junior and ex-member score awards

From Manila Bulletin (www.mb.com.ph)
By JONATHAN M. HICAP
MANILA, Philippines – The Seoul Central District Court sentenced Korean rapper MC Mong (real name Shin Dong-Hyun) on Monday to six months imprisonment, suspended for one year, for being found guilty of delaying his enlistment in the Korean military by applying for government exams and going on trips overseas. He was likewise ordered to do 120 hours of community service.

Korean teas, not just green

Light sends soft rays through the floor-length windows of Ga Hwa Dang, a traditional Korean hanok-turned-teahouse located in Samcheong-dong, Seoul.
Behind the counter, manager Kim Yu-ri painstakingly prepares the establishment’s brews.
Surprisingly enough, less than half the 19 teas on the menu are leaf-based. Instead, a majority are made with fruit, roots and seeds.

Korean recipe: Japchae (stir-fried noodles with vegetables)

Recipes with noodles are a staple in many Asian countries including South Korea, Philippines, Thailand, Vietnam and Malaysia.

I first tasted japchae (stir-fried noodles with vegetables) at a Korean restaurant in Malate in Manila, Philippines and since then, I always order it. I think the appeal of japchae lies in the taste. It has a sweet flavor. In addition, it has many wonderful ingredients including beef and spinach.
